如何登录亚马逊VPS?
| 步骤 |
操作说明 |
使用工具 |
| 1 |
获取亚马逊VPS的IP地址和登录凭证 |
亚马逊AWS控制台 |
| 2 |
使用SSH客户端连接VPS |
PuTTY(Windows)或终端(Mac/Linux) |
| 3 |
输入登录命令和凭证 |
SSH命令:ssh -i [密钥文件路径] [用户名]@[IP地址] |
| 4 |
验证连接成功 |
检查命令行提示符是否显示VPS系统信息 |
亚马逊VPS登录步骤详解
亚马逊VPS(即AWS EC2实例)是常用的云计算服务,以下是详细的登录步骤:
登录准备
- 获取登录凭证:在AWS控制台创建EC2实例时,系统会生成密钥对(.pem文件)和公有IP地址。
- 下载SSH工具:
- Windows用户推荐使用PuTTY
- Mac/Linux用户可直接使用终端
详细操作步骤
步骤1:连接准备
- 确保安全组规则已开放22端口(SSH默认端口)
- 将.pem文件权限设置为400(Linux/Mac:
chmod 400 your-key-pair.pem)
步骤2:建立连接
ssh -i "your-key-pair.pem" ec2-user@your-instance-public-dns
(注:用户名可能因系统镜像不同而变化,Amazon Linux默认用户名为
ec2-user)
步骤3:验证连接
成功连接后,终端会显示类似以下信息:
Last login: Mon Nov 1 23:02:43 2025 from 203.0.113.1
[ec2-user@ip-172-31-42-17 ~]$
常见问题解决方案
| 问题现象 |
可能原因 |
解决方法 |
| “Permission denied” |
密钥文件权限过大 |
执行chmod 400 your-key-pair.pem |
| 连接超时 |
安全组未放行22端口 |
检查并修改安全组入站规则 |
| “Bad owner or permissions” |
密钥文件格式错误 |
在PuTTYgen中转换.pem为.ppk格式 |
| 用户名错误 |
系统镜像差异 |
尝试ubuntu(Ubuntu)、ec2-user(Amazon Linux)等常见用户名 |
注意事项
- 首次连接时系统会询问是否添加主机密钥,输入
yes确认
- 建议使用密钥对登录而非密码,安全性更高
- 连接失败时可检查VPS状态是否为"running"
发表评论